[Impact] Updates may run into file conflicts if the old networkmanagement is not removed, potentially rendering 13.04 -> 13.10 upgrades defunct. This is resolved by introducing appropriate Breaks/Replaces relationships between plasma-nm and plasma-widget-networkmanagement. [Test Case] * On 13.10 * Remove plasma-nm - * Install plasma-widget-networkmanagement from 13.04 [1] + * Install plasma-widget-networkmanagement and libsolidcontrol from 13.04 [1] [2] * Upgrade - [Regression Potential] + [Regression Potential] * None, unless I get the relationship wrong in which case an upgrade would be unable to resolve the dependencies and break there rather than on file conflicts. Which is actually preferable FWIW.
